Get a Bonus When Buying IHG One Rewards Points

Until October 29, 2025, enjoy a bonus of up to 100% when buying IHG One Rewards points. The lowest price per point (0.5 US cents) applies when purchasing 11,000 points or more.

Remember that Iberostar Resorts all-inclusive hotels are part of the IHG hotel chain, allowing you to redeem your IHG One Rewards points for free nights at these all-inclusive hotels!

This is a recurring promotion that returns every month, with a variation in the bonus percentage. The last bonus was also generous and could go up to 100% at the beginning of October 2025.

We do not recommend buying points during regular periods. However, it can be advantageous if you plan a specific use in the coming months, especially when the bonus offer can go up to 100%.

You can buy up to 200,000 points per calendar year and receive up to 200,000 bonus points, for a total of 400,000 points. This will cost you US$2,000 (approximately CA$2,520 based on the current exchange rate).

However, for this promotion, you can buy up to 300,000 points.

Is It Worthwhile to Buy IHG One Rewards Points?

The answer to this question is… Yes and no.

In Canada, we do not have the advantage of credit cards that allow us to accumulate IHG One Rewards points directly or indirectly (unlike the multiple credit card options to earn Marriott Bonvoy points).

Buying IHG One Rewards points can be a worthwhile solution only when you have a very specific goal in mind.

Milesopedia values IHG One Rewards points at 0.5 US cents (or approximately 0.62 Canadian cents), but with a promotional bonus, their effective value can be much higher.

Bottom Line

Buying IHG points can therefore be interesting for some, especially if you have a specific travel goal or if you want to top up your points balance to get a free night.

With the current promotion, you can get up to 100% bonus points, but the offer is targeted, so not all members will necessarily receive the maximum.

If you are not in one of these situations, we advise against buying points and instead suggest prioritizing other programs like Marriott Bonvoy, where it is much easier to earn points through credit cards!
